In my case the issue causing this was because the clip holding the battery cover shut had broken off, so I kept it shut with tape or elastic bands. if the cover was even slightly open then it told me it was flat. once I realised that was the issue I just made the tape a bit tighter when the batteries low warning came on rather than changing them pointlessly.
On mine, the battery terminal on the inside of the battery case is broken, by opening and shutting the cover a few times until it contacts properly it is normally OK. Anyone know where I can buy a new contact plate in theUK?

I recommend to all my customers with AA battery life issues to try Energizer Lithium AA's. Virtually all battery issues solved. I think alkaline batteries are being manufactured poorly, these days, so even brand new they aren't great.
Check that you are using the correct type of batteries and that they are rechageable as i found i had a similer problem when using just normal non recargeable
Did the batteries come with the camera? If not, they might not be a high enough mah rating. Some batteries, even though brand new, may not be strong enough to power a camera.
Ive had the same problem with my camera and found that it was the quality of the batterys. you have to use good quality high drain batterys for digital cameras.
